Crawl space services involve inspecting, cleaning, and repairing the area beneath a home’s main level. This space, often hidden from view, can develop issues over time that affect the overall health of a property. Local contractors may remove debris, install vapor barriers, or address moisture problems to help maintain a dry and stable environment. Proper crawl space maintenance can prevent common issues such as mold growth, wood rot, and pest infestations, contributing to a healthier living space and protecting the home's foundation.
Many problems homeowners encounter in their crawl spaces are related to excess moisture and poor ventilation. These issues can lead to mold and mildew buildup, which may impact indoor air quality and cause structural damage if left unaddressed. Additionally, pests like termites and rodents often find crawl spaces to be attractive habitats, risking further damage to support beams and insulation. Service providers can identify and resolve these problems through targeted repairs, moisture control solutions, and pest exclusion measures, helping to preserve the integrity of the property.

The overview below groups typical Crawl Space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Rutherford County, TN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or crawl space repairs, such as sealing leaks or adding vapor barriers,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ine projects fall within this middle range, with fewer jobs reaching the higher end of the spectrum.
Moisture and Mold Treatment - Addressing mold or moisture issues in a crawl space can cost between $1,000 and $3,000 for most homes. Larger or more complex treatments may exceed this range, but most projects stay within the lower to mid tiers.
Structural Reinforcement - Reinforcing or leveling a sagging crawl space typically costs $2,500-$7,000, depending on the extent of work needed. Many projects are in the middle of this range, with significant structural repairs pushing costs higher.
Full Crawl Space Replacement - Complete replacement of a crawl space can range from $8,000 to $15,000 or more for larger, complex projects. Most replacements fall into the higher tiers, though smaller, straightforward jobs tend to be less costly.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
